  • The MBA program allows for concentrations in Accounting, Finance, Human Resource Management, Information Assurance, International Business, Leadership Studies, Management Information Systems, Tourism and Hospitality and a general option customized to your interest. These concentrations enable you to build a valuable MBA to meet your specific needs.
  • Didn’t earn a business degree the first time around? No problem. Our curriculum offers foundation courses that can be completed if you don’t have an undergraduate business degree. MBA Course Schedule
  • FHSU is accredited by the Higher Learning Commission of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ools. The College of Business and Leadership has also been accepted in the accreditation process for the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business (AACSB).
